Hujaipur Population - Karbi Anglong, Assam

Hujaipur is a very small village located in Diphu Circle of Karbi Anglong district, Assam with total 8 families residing. The Hujaipur village has population of 30 of which 16 are males while 14 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Hujaipur village population of children with age 0-6 is 1 which makes up 3.33 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Hujaipur village is 875 which is lower than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Hujaipur as per census is 0, lower than Assam average of 962.

Hujaipur village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Hujaipur village was 20.69 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Hujaipur Male literacy stands at 31.25 % while female literacy rate was 7.69 %.
